Chapter 48 Sowing Discord
The following morning, Zhao Heng was personally escorted to the palace gate by Li Lingcheng.
The square paved with bluestone outside the palace gate was empty, with only a few carriages waiting.
Luan Ding and Ji Cheng stood beside a carriage. When they saw Zhao Heng's figure in the distance, they were both delighted, but they quickly composed themselves and waited solemnly.
Li Lingcheng escorted Zhao Heng to the carriage before stopping, bowing respectfully, and whispering with a smile, "Young Master's response this time was measured and skillful, showing promising signs of composure. Although His Majesty did not explicitly state it, I could clearly see it, and His Majesty is truly pleased."
Zhao Heng returned the greeting with a cupped-hand salute, bowing even deeper than Li Lingcheng: "If it weren't for Lingcheng's help yesterday, I fear I would have lost my composure in the palace. I will remember this kindness."
He wasn't just being polite; the timing of handing over the handkerchief yesterday, and Li Lingcheng's seemingly unintentional actions in the hall, were all measured and appropriate.
Those people in the palace who have served King Zhao for so many years are all shrewd and capable.
Since the other party has shown this favor, he must accept it, and accept it solemnly.
Li Lingcheng smiled but didn't respond. Instead, she stepped aside to avoid a half-bow and raised her hand in a gesture of support: "His Majesty is very concerned about you, young master. If you need anything in the future, you can simply send a letter to the palace as per usual procedure. Although I am of low rank, I can still manage to run errands and deliver messages."
This statement, though subtle, is already a statement of opinion.
Zhao Heng understood and nodded, saying, "I will remember your kindness, Prime Minister."
The two exchanged a few more pleasantries, and the atmosphere was quite harmonious. Zhao Heng also kept to himself, only expressing his gratitude and not mentioning anything else in his conversation.
Finally, before boarding the carriage, Zhao Heng turned back to bid farewell to Li Lingcheng. As he looked up, he caught a glimpse of several figures standing on the palace gate and city wall.
One of them, dressed in dark blue eunuch robes, was leaning against the crenellations of the city tower, gazing gloomily in this direction, clearly observing the scene of his farewell to Li Lingcheng.
Despite the distance, Zhao Heng could still recognize that it was Gao Qu.
Zhao Heng had intended to board his carriage and leave, but in that instant, a thought flashed through his mind, and he suddenly called out loudly towards the city gate, "Eunuch Gao!"
Not only that, he also raised his arm, making a gesture to beckon him closer.
The key was that his voice sounded exceptionally clear in front of the empty palace gates in the early morning. The gatekeepers at the palace gates, the soldiers changing shifts, and the drivers of several carriages waiting to pass in the distance all looked over in response to the sound.
Gao Qu on the city wall was clearly taken aback.
He probably hadn't expected Zhao Heng to suddenly call him in front of everyone. A look of surprise flashed across his clean-shaven face, but he quickly became serious, his brows furrowed, and annoyance flashed in his eyes. He simply stood there without moving, clearly intending to pretend he hadn't heard and ignore it.
Gao Qu looked around and saw that most of the people at the palace gate had subconsciously followed Zhao Heng's gaze. Li Lingcheng also turned around and looked at the city tower. His expression was unclear, but it was probably somewhat meaningful.
Further away, the gatekeepers, armored soldiers, and others all focused their gazes on Gao Qu, their curiosity and speculation clearly mixed with a hint of watching the spectacle.
Gao Qu was caught in a dilemma. With everyone watching, he couldn't pretend not to know anything. He could only suppress his anger, walk down the city wall with a gloomy face, and head towards the palace gate.
Upon seeing him approach, a hint of a smile flashed across Zhao Heng's eyes, and he bowed to Li Lingcheng once more:
"Please wait a moment, Magistrate Li. I have a few words to say to Eunuch Gao. My guest has already arrived, so I dare not trouble you to see me off any further. I will remember your hospitality yesterday and your farewell today. If I have the opportunity in the future, I will certainly seek your advice again."
Li Lingcheng readily agreed with a smile, then reminded the young master to be careful on the road before turning back to the palace.
As Li Lingcheng passed Gao Qu, he did not forget to nod slightly to him. Gao Qu snorted inwardly, but could only give a forced response on the surface. Then, he led a few attendant eunuchs to Zhao Heng's carriage.
He waved for his attendants to stop a few steps away, then stepped forward himself. Without even looking at Luan Ding and his companion, he narrowed his eyes and asked in a stiff tone, "Young master, what brings you here?"
Zhao Heng simply stood on the carriage and beckoned to the man: "Eunuch, come closer and speak."
Gao Qu's face darkened further, but recalling the scene of Zhao Heng staying overnight in the palace and dining with the King of Zhao last night, and seeing that he seemed to have a secret to tell him, he ultimately had to restrain his impatience and take half a step closer, considering Zhao Heng's current momentum.
He wanted to see what this brat was up to.
Then Zhao Heng leaned over and whispered something very quickly, in a voice that only the two of them could hear.
"Your Excellency, guess what my uncle will think I said to you later?"
The moment he finished speaking, Zhao Heng straightened up and took a step back with a smile.
Gao Qu remained listening intently, his face still blank, clearly not understanding the meaning of the words. When he saw Zhao Heng laugh, he even unconsciously chuckled twice, looking rather comical.
"In that case, Eunuch Gao, it's settled then!"
Seeing his expression, Zhao Heng laughed heartily, giving him no chance to react, and immediately raised his voice, saying, "Heng, then we await good news from Eunuch Gao!"
His voice was neither too loud nor too soft, just loud enough for people within a few feet to hear faintly. After speaking, without waiting for a response, he simply bowed to Gao Qu, then turned around, lifted the carriage curtain, and bent down to enter the carriage.
"Return to the residence."
Although Luan Ding and Ji Cheng did not understand why, they acted immediately upon hearing the order. Luan Ding and Ji Cheng jumped onto the carriage shaft together, flicked the reins, and the carriage immediately started moving slowly away from the palace gate.
Gao Qu remained rooted to the spot, motionless for a long while.
He was still pondering Zhao Heng's two seemingly random whispered words, unable to grasp their deeper meaning for the time being.
Before he could even process the first provocative whisper, the second, louder voice, seemed to have finalized an agreement with him.
What does this mean?
After the carriage had traveled a short distance, he looked around blankly and saw armored soldiers on the city wall leaning over their halberds to look down; the gatekeeper at the palace gate was still holding bamboo slips in his hand, but had forgotten to register them; several servants who had gone out of the palace to make purchases that morning also stopped pushing their carts and kept looking in this direction.
Gao Qu's expression suddenly changed drastically. He abruptly turned his head to look in the direction Zhao Heng's carriage had gone. But the carriage had already traveled nearly a hundred paces and was far away.
"Grandpa..." A low-ranking eunuch whom he had adopted as his godson approached, lowered his voice, and asked mysteriously, "Are we going to get in touch with Lord Chunping's household? But back when Lord Chunping went to Qin, we were..."
"idiot!"
Gao Qu was so angry he was practically spitting fire, veins throbbing on his forehead, but he only dared to suppress his rage and shout, "I've been tricked by that brat! This is a scheme to sow discord, a show for others, to make Young Master Yan suspicious of me!"
At this point, Gao Qu was startled.
He suddenly looked up and glanced around. Several gatekeepers, seeing him looking at them, hurriedly lowered their heads and pretended to be busy. The armored soldiers on the city wall also turned their gaze away, feigning to patrol.
Gao Quxin's heart sank. He knew that explaining now would only make things worse.
Zhao Heng's move was clumsy, but it struck right at his Achilles' heel. Gongzi Yan was inherently suspicious and jealous; if he were to hear of this…
He dared not think any further.
With a sharp flick of his sleeve, Gao Qu ignored the eunuch, his face grim, and turned to stride quickly into the palace. He needed to find a way to clarify the matter to Prince Yan as soon as possible, so his pace quickened, and the hem of his palace robes almost flew up.
